The MCF5272VM66 is a Microcontroller designed by the notable manufacturer NXP USA Inc. It falls under the MCF527x series which is renowned for its exceptional performance and high efficiency. This component features a 196-LBGA package/case, making it suitable for surface mount applications.
The MCF5272VM66 operates within a reliable temperature range of 0°C to 70°C (TA), perfect for environments with standard temperature conditions. To power this Microcontroller, it requires a supply voltage (Vcc/Vdd) ranging between 3V to 3.6V, ensuring stable performance through consistent voltage supply. The supplier device package for this component is the 196-LBGA, measuring 15×15, compatible with industry-standard device footprints.
One of the notable traits of this component has a commendable 32 I/O number, increasing its interface capacity significantly. It is important to note that this part is considered obsolete, suggesting that the manufacturer no longer produces the part, however, it does not compromise the component’s functionality or effectiveness in existing designs.
